2017-08-17 7 views
0

以下のような動的な引数を持っているURLとnginxの場所のブロックで301リターンを使用するためのベストプラクティスは何ですか:nginxの場所301に戻り

location = /property/:propertyId/requests { 
      return 301 /property/:propertyId/requests/open; 
    } 

答えて

0

あなたは

以下のようなものを使用することができます
location ~ ^/property/(?<propertyId>\d+)/requests/?$ { 
    rewrite^/property/$propertyId/requests/open permanent; 
} 

私はプロパティIDが数値であると仮定して\d+を使用しますが、それが英数字の場合は、パターンを変更することができている